Abstract

A side cutter apparatus for an excavating machine having a plurality of spaced rotating digging wheels mounted on a common horizontal shaft, each wheel having a pair of spaced sidewalls, and having frame rails partially extending into the spaces between adjacent wheels; which includes a base plate affixed to the periphery of a cut-away section of a sidewall adjacent to the open space between the wheels; a pivotal side cutter including a back panel disposed in the cut-away section and pivotally mounted at its lower end on the base plate so as to pivot into the open space, a front panel disposed essentially parallel to the back panel and pivotally mounted at its lower end on a common axis with the back panel so as to be pivotally movable therewith, a cutting tooth affixed to the upper portion of the front panel and extending into the open space, a roller rotatably mounted on an axis perpendicular to the front panel and extending through the same into a vertical space between the panels wherein the roller is directly adjacent to the open space between the wheels; a spring for urging the side cutter into the open space; a stop for limiting the pivotal movement of the side cutter, a cam for moving the side cutter into a closed position against the action of the spring, and a track for maintaining the side cutter in the closed position during a predetermined portion of the wheel's rotation.
